Отчет Predictability Chart
Подробное описание отчета Predictability Chart в Jira Metrics Plugin, его построение и интерпретация.
Обзор
Predictability Chart (Диаграмма предсказуемости) - это метрика, предложенная Kanban University для измерения стабильности и предсказуемости потока работы команды. Этот отчет помогает оценить, насколько надежно команда может прогнозировать время выполнения задач.
Построение Predictability Chart
1. Сбор данных
- Собираются данные о lead time или cycle time для каждой задачи за определенный период.
- Важно обеспечить точность данных и охват достаточного промежутка времени для статистической значимости.
2. Расчет процентилей
- 50-й процентиль (медиана): Значение времени, ниже которого выполняется 50% задач.
- 98-й процентиль: Значение времени, ниже которого выполняется 98% задач.
3. Вычисление отношения 98% / 50%
- Отношение = 98-й процентиль / 50-й процентиль
- Это отношение показывает степень вариативности в процессе. Меньшее значение означает более предсказуемый процесс.
4. Построение графика
- Ось X: Временная шкала (дни, недели или месяцы)
- Ось Y: Рассчитанное отношение 98% / 50% за каждый период
- Точки на графике соединяются линией для визуализации трендов
Структура диаграммы
[Изображение Predictability Chart]
На диаграмме представлена линия, показывающая изменение отношения 98% / 50% во времени. Значения на графике отражают степень предсказуемости процесса.
Интерпретация значений
- Значение близкое к 1: Указывает на высокую предсказуемость и низкую вариативность процесса.
- Значения от 1 до 2: Считаются очень хорошими показателями.
- Значения от 2 до 3: Указывают на умеренную предсказуемость.
- Значения выше 3: Сигнализируют о низкой предсказуемости и высокой вариативности в процессе.
Анализ трендов
- Снижение отношения со временем: Указывает на улучшение процессов и повышение стабильности.
- Увеличение отношения: Может сигнализировать о возможных проблемах или изменениях в процессе, требующих внимания.
- Стабильная линия: Говорит о неизменном, но не улучшающемся процессе.
Настройка отчета
Под диаграммой расположены элементы управления:
- Resolution: Выбор временного интервала (день, неделя, месяц).
- Select Swimlanes: Фильтрация по конкретным свимлейнам.
- Select Columns: Выбор колонок для анализа.
- Filtering Mode: Выбор режима фильтрации (Activity/Columns).
- Completion Columns: Выбор колонок завершения (для режима Columns).
Практические советы по использованию
-
Регулярный мониторинг: Обновляйте и анализируйте график регулярно для своевременного обнаружения отклонений.
-
Поиск причин вариативности: При высоком отношении анализируйте задачи с длительным временем выполнения для выявления причин задержек.
-
Внедрение улучшений: Используйте полученные данные для оптимизации процессов, устранения узких мест и повышения эффективности.
-
Комплексный анализ: Рассматривайте Predictability Chart в сочетании с другими метриками, такими как Cycle Time и Throughput, для полноценного анализа.
-
Учет контекста: Принимайте во внимание специфику проекта и команды при интерпретации значений.
Ограничения метрики
- Не учитывает размер или сложность задач.
- Может быть чувствительна к выбросам, особенно при небольшом количестве задач.
- Не отражает причины изменения предсказуемости.
Заключение
Predictability Chart - ценный инструмент для оценки стабильности и предсказуемости процесса разработки. Регулярный анализ этой метрики поможет вам выявлять области для улучшения, оптимизировать рабочие процессы и повышать эффективность команды.